21xrx.com
2025-03-27 16:28:08 Thursday
文章检索 我的文章 写文章
C++如何输出n个字母?
2023-07-05 14:49:11 深夜i     --     --
C++ 输出 n个字母

C++是一种强大的编程语言,拥有丰富的输出和输入函数,可以轻松地输出n个字母。下面将介绍几种实现方法。

方法一:使用循环和输出函数

我们可以使用for循环来输出n个字母,如下所示:

#include <iostream>
using namespace std;
int main()
{
  int n;
  char c = 'a';
  cout << "请输入想要输出的字母数量:";
  cin >> n;
  for(int i=0; i<n; i++)
  {
    cout << c << " ";
    c++; //使c变成下一个字母
  }
  return 0;
}

在该代码中,我们定义了一个字符变量c,初始值为'a'。接着,我们使用for循环来输出n个字母,每输出一个字母,就将c自增1,使其变成下一个字母。

方法二:使用数组和循环

我们也可以使用数组来存储n个字母,然后使用循环输出数组内的字母。以下是代码示例:


#include <iostream>

using namespace std;

int main()

{

  int n;

  char letters[] = 'f';

  cout << "请输入想要输出的字母数量:";

  cin >> n;

  for(int i=0; i<n; i++)

  {

    cout << letters[i] << " ";

  }

  return 0;

}

在该代码中,我们定义了一个字符数组letters,存储了26个字母。接着,我们使用for循环来输出n个字母,每次输出数组内对应的字母即可。

综上所述,C++可以轻松地输出n个字母,我们可以根据实际需要选择不同的实现方法。无论哪种方法,都需要使用循环和输出函数来实现。

  
  

评论区

    相似文章